OverviewInspired by the highly esteemed Lowell Weil, Sr, DPM, and graduates of the Weil Foot & Ankle Institute, Tips and Tricks in Podiatric Surgery: The Foot and Ankle brings together a wealth of practical surgical guidance from fellowship trained foot and ankle surgeons in a highly readable, lavishly illustrated format. Brief chapters provide pearls for success, tips and tricks, and perils to avoid for both primary and revision surgeries. Edited by Drs. Thomas S. Roukis, John S. Anderson, Jeffrey R. Baker, Jarrett D. Cain, and Lowell Weil, Jr, this useful reference clearly demonstrates the “how-to” of every procedure highlighted by color photos and select videos for clear visual guidance. Contains 54 concise, well-illustrated chapters covering challenging surgical techniques and revision surgeries, as well as soft tissue concerns in the foot and ankle Covers a broad range of evidence-based procedures: traditional open, minimal incision, and percutaneous Shares the tips, tricks, pearls, and tried-and-true methods of global podiatric and orthopaedic surgeons who are recognized as experts in their particular area of foot and ankle surgery Ideal for both the experienced podiatric foot and ankle surgeon and those in training Full Product DetailsAuthor: THOMAS S.
